Ivo Ulich (born 9 September 1974) is a former Czech footballer who played as a midfielder.

Club career[]

Ulich, a midfielder, played for Slavia Prague, Borussia Mönchengladbach, Vissel Kobe and Dynamo Dresden. He retired from football in 2008, but stayed with Dynamo Dresden as a scout.

Ulich spent most of his Gambrinus liga career at Slavia Prague. In 1995, as a player of SK Hradec Králové, he won the Talent of the Year award at the Czech Footballer of the Year awards.[1]

He currently plays futsal for Slavia.
